The emergence of 5G know-how is significantly altering the panorama of Internet of Things (IoT) connectivity, enabling a plethora of purposes that were as quickly as only theoretical. As the demand for seamless and rapid communication grows, 5G presents an answer that addresses the limitations of previous generations of wireless networks. The enhanced bandwidth, decreased latency, and more reliable connections supplied by 5G facilitate a new era of interconnected gadgets.


IoT, by its very nature, thrives on connectivity. Millions of sensors, actuators, and devices are continuously communicating information to each other and to centralized methods to allow automation and enhance operational efficiencies. Current 4G networks often wrestle to deal with the huge quantities of knowledge generated by these gadgets, leading to connectivity points that may hinder efficiency. 5G, with its advanced know-how, alleviates many of these points and promotes a more robust ecosystem.


One of probably the most significant benefits of 5G expertise is its ultra-low latency. Network latency refers to the time it takes for data to journey from its supply to its vacation spot and back again. In a world the place gadgets need to communicate instantaneously—such as in industrial purposes, autonomous vehicles, and remote healthcare—this function becomes important. With latencies as low as one millisecond, 5G allows for real-time knowledge processing and decision-making.


The elevated capability of 5G networks means potentially extra units can connect seamlessly without sacrificing connectivity quality. This is particularly crucial for smart cities, where quite a few gadgets corresponding to traffic lights, surveillance cameras, and environmental sensors need to function in concord. The ability to attach as a lot as a million gadgets per square kilometer represents an astounding leap forward, paving the method in which for smarter, more environment friendly city environments.

Enhanced information charges are one other revolutionary facet of 5G know-how. Speeds can reach as much as 20 Gbps, which is drastically higher than what 4G presents. This elevated bandwidth allows for quicker uploads and downloads of large files. Industries that depend on in depth knowledge transfers, similar to healthcare, are set to benefit immensely. Remote surgical procedures, the place real-time video feeds are mandatory, and diagnostics that require prompt knowledge transfer can reap the advantages of this newfound pace.


Reliability and stability are essential not just for private gadgets but in addition for critical infrastructure. In sectors like healthcare, finance, and smart grid management, the repercussions of network failures could be dire. 5G technology goals for a better stage of reliability, aiming for a connection success fee of up to 99.999%. This stage of trust in community efficiency will drive increased adoption of IoT in mission-critical functions, where downtime is not an possibility.

Security is paramount in any community protocol, extra so in IoT the place units are more and more targeted by cyber threats. With the implementation of 5G, there are improved security features and protocols designed to guard sensitive knowledge. End-to-end encryption, improved authentication, and network slicing permit for safer and segmented environments. This is particularly necessary for sectors like finance and healthcare, where data integrity and confidentiality are essential.




As 5G technology becomes extra widespread, the potential for innovation grows exponentially. Companies are already exploring use cases that leverage the capabilities of 5G-empowered IoT. Smart agriculture, for example, guarantees improved crop administration via sensors that monitor soil health and weather patterns. The data collected can be transmitted in real time, enabling farmers to make knowledgeable decisions rapidly, resulting in larger yields and lowered waste.
